Probably because they were so rotted he was in pain, couldn’t eat properly. At two, it will be another 4 years before is adult teeth start coming in and they are in danger of coming in rotted if the rot in the baby teeth isn’t stopped.
The health of baby teeth helps determine the health of your adult teeth, and some disorders (Amelogenesis imperfecta) do exist which create issues related to enamel strength and gum health. Assuming abuse off the bat (as some have) is a little unfair.
